Job description

Hawthorne Cat is a family-owned company that has led its markets for over 60 years in the sale, rental, and servicing of construction machinery and power generation equipment for industries on which our communities depend like agriculture, construction, marine, and government.

Every member of our team plays a significant role in our success. Hawthorne Cat hires individuals who share our vision of Building Better Communities with our Customers and our values of Passion, Respect, Integrity, Dedication and Excellence (PRIDE).

If you are looking to build your future with an established, thriving company with countless opportunities for growth and advancement, you’ve come to the right place! At Hawthorne Cat, we’re always looking for exceptionally skilled, hardworking individuals interested in contributing to our success and the success of the communities that we serve.

Our people are our most valuable asset. That’s why at Hawthorne Cat we are committed to a comprehensive employee benefit program that helps our employees stay healthy, feel secure, and maintain a work/life balance.

POSITION SUMMARY: The Lead Service Technician assists and develops technicians in all phases of troubleshooting and repair of equipment in a manner that reflects the company’s vision. Serves as the main contact between the shop personnel and Technical Services Department concerning problems that arise during the repair of the equipment. The shop lead is also responsible for the leadership and development of technicians in their area.

PHYSICAL DEMANDS:

  • Walking and moving about on foot up or downstairs and often through uneven terrain.
  • Hands/arms operating equipment, hand and power tools.
  • Lifting: Up to 50 lbs. daily, frequent exertion. Raises or lowers miscellaneous equipment parts and tools.
  • Handling: Seizes helps or works with hands.
  • Reaching: Extends hands and arms in any direction.
  • Standing: Remains in standing position if required for certain repair or maintenance work.
  • Climbing: In and out of equipment.
  • Vision: Read work tickets, parts and service books and operate heavy equipment.
  • Talking: Communications by radio, phone, and in person in English.
  • Sitting: Sits in equipment and in vehicles.
  • Stooping: Bends body downward and forward by bending at knees or waist.
  • Hearing: Hears well enough to discern mechanical problems for safety in and around shop and construction sites and to receive communication by radio, phone and in person.
  • Laying: Lies in prone position under vehicles and equipment.

ENVIRONMENTAL:

  • Noise: Works in conditions with constant or intermittent noise.
  • Temperatures/Weather: Works in a warehouse and outside with variations of temperature and weather.
  • Exposure: Foul odors, fumes and harsh substances.
